Nowadays, the construction of smart grid is faced with two problems which are urgent to be solved, one is the lengthened construction period, and the other is professional fusion. Therefore, it is of great necessity to reposition the station overall functional requirements and equipment configuration based on overall sight of the Smart Substation to realize the transformation of grid technology mode and construction mode, as the society is under great development.Based on this perspective, the conventional limits of the equipment-supplier-leading mode are broken in this paper, and the brand-new mode "design-leading equipment manufacturing" is proposed, which is designed for the key techniques in the field of intelligent substation, and is relying on the pilot projects for national network. The following several aspects of work are focused:1. The concept of an intelligent module's integration with the primary equipment in place and a design and manufacturing mode of the intelligent primary equipment are proposed. And an integrated secondary equipment bidding and procurement mode is put forward, which realizes the innovation of the project construction mode.2. Analyzing the new generation of intelligent station integrated optimization design technology qualitatively from two dimensions, the structure optimization of secondary equipment screen cabinet and devices, and the function optimization and integration of the secondary system. A configuration principle and a typical partition scheme of the secondary system modularization are presented. Combined with the development of the current integrated manufacturing industry, the integrated optimization design technology and modular design technology are applied to the prefabricated combination secondary equipment module. What's more, relying on the optimal integrated configuration of the secondary equipment of the total station in the project of 110kV substation located in Huangshanhao Village, typical modular configuration scheme of secondary system in 11 OkV outdoor AIS substation is then proposed.3. Typical schemes of cable wiring installation are illustrated. And the total prefabricated cable statistics are made under the typical interval division. For the secondary standard interface, statistics of aviation plug and ferrule are also made to regulate the "plug to use" technology standardization design, which has a certain reference value to the following intelligence substation construction.4. Results summary and expectations about the application and practice of high integration intelligent primary equipment, small environmental protection equipment and modular construction strategy in intelligent substation optimization design are elaborated.A new generation of intelligent substation using integrated design, supply integration, integration debug mode, which achieves the goal of "smaller covering area, less cost, higher reliability", reaches a new technology level of "system highly integrated, structure rationally distributed, equipment advanced and applicable, economical, environmental friendly and energy saving, support and dispatch in one".
